Harnessing the Power of Membrane Technology

One of the most exciting frontiers in water treatment is the rapid evolution of membrane technology. Researchers have been pushing the boundaries of membrane materials, designs, and processes, unlocking unprecedented levels of efficiency and versatility.

Imagine a world where wastewater is no longer a burden, but a valuable resource. With the advent of advanced membrane filtration systems, we can now extract and purify water from the most challenging sources, including industrial effluents, agricultural runoff, and even sewage. These high-performance membranes act as selective gatekeepers, allowing us to remove a broad spectrum of contaminants – from microplastics and heavy metals to pathogens and pharmaceuticals – with remarkable precision.

But the true transformative power of membrane technology lies in its ability to enable water reuse on a grand scale. By reclaiming and repurposing water that would have otherwise been discarded, we can significantly reduce our reliance on freshwater sources and curb the strain on our finite water supplies. This circular approach to water management not only conserves resources but also mitigates the environmental impact of wastewater discharge.

Harnessing the Power of Biological Processes

While membrane technology is revolutionizing the physical aspects of water treatment, the integration of biological processes is unlocking equally groundbreaking advancements. Researchers are exploring the untapped potential of microorganisms to enhance water purification and resource recovery.

Imagine a wastewater treatment plant that functions like a well-choreographed dance, with microbes as the lead performers. By leveraging the innate capabilities of these tiny biological powerhouses, we can harness their natural processes to remove contaminants, recover valuable resources, and even generate renewable energy.

Through the strategic deployment of bioreactors and biocatalysts, we can engineer ecosystems that efficiently break down organic matter, extract nutrients, and even produce biofuels from wastewater. This symbiotic relationship between technology and biology is ushering in a new era of water treatment that is not only more sustainable but also more economically viable.

Harnessing the Power of Digital Transformation

As the world of water treatment and reuse becomes increasingly complex, the integration of digital technologies is proving to be a game-changer. Cutting-edge innovations in IoT, artificial intelligence, and data analytics are empowering us to optimize every aspect of the water management cycle.

Imagine a water treatment facility that can anticipate and respond to changes in demand, water quality, and environmental conditions in real-time. Through the deployment of smart sensors and advanced analytics, we can now monitor and control every facet of the water treatment process with unprecedented precision.

By leveraging predictive algorithms and machine learning, we can forecast water usage patterns, identify potential threats, and proactively adjust treatment strategies to ensure the most efficient and effective use of our water resources. This digital transformation is not only improving the reliability and resilience of our water systems but also enabling us to make more informed decisions that prioritize sustainability and environmental stewardship.
